Quack Forest Trail


One of the most famous ecotrails in Chester is the Quack Forest Trail. This route is part of a nature reserve and passes through dense forests and riverside areas. The length of the trail is about 8 kilometers, and it can be completed in a few hours while enjoying the beauty of nature. During the journey, tourists can not only see unique species of flora and fauna in the region but also stop by ancient bridges, which, together with the surrounding landscape, create a special atmosphere. The Quack Forest Trail is ideal for those who want to be alone and enjoy the silence without being distracted by external noises.

Din River Trail


The Din River Trail is a beautiful route for those who prefer easy walks along water bodies and don’t want to exert themselves physically. The length of the route is about 5 kilometers, and it can be covered in a couple of hours. During the journey along the river, you can not only enjoy the views but also marvel at the variety of aquatic ecosystems. It’s a great choice for nature photographers and those who want to observe birds and other animals inhabiting the area.
Along the trail, there are several picturesque viewpoints and ancient mills that provide insight into the region’s past. This route is perfect for small groups or family outings.

Chester Ecotrail


For those who want to not only enjoy nature but also immerse themselves in the atmosphere of history, the Chester Ecotrail is recommended. This route combines elements of eco-tourism and historical sightseeing. The length of the ecotrail is about 10 kilometers, and it connects several natural and historical sites, including ancient forts and defensive fortifications that once protected the city from external threats.
The ecotrail takes you through old wooden bridges, numerous fields and meadows, and gives you the opportunity to learn a lot about Chester’s life and culture in the Medieval era. This is the ideal route for those looking for both solitude and educational moments during their journey.

What to Bring with You?


When planning a hike along the ecotrails of Chester, it’s important to remember a few things. Although most routes do not require serious physical preparation, it’s essential to bring comfortable shoes, water, and light snacks. Your hiking kit should also include sun protection, mosquito repellent, and a raincoat—the weather in the region can change quickly. Some sections of the routes may be more difficult, so it’s a good idea to familiarize yourself with the map and choose the appropriate route based on your preferences and physical condition.
